Exporting and Manufacturing

Once the design is finalized, export the model in formats compatible with manufacturing processes, such as STL or STEP files. Fusion 360 also offers CAM tools for generating toolpathy for CNC machining. This integration edulines the transition from digital design to fyzical concent.
